Connecting a fiber cable

WARNING!
Do not stare into any fiber port when you connect an optical fiber. The laser light emitted from the optical
fiber might hurt your eyes.
To connect a fiber cable:
1.
Remove the dust plug from a fiber port of the router.
2.
Remove the dust cover from the transceiver module, and plug the end without a pull latch into the
fiber port.
3.
Remove the dust cover from the fiber connector.
4.
Identify the Rx and Tx ports. Plug the LC connector at one end of one fiber cable into the Rx port
of the router and the LC connector at the other end into the Tx port of the peer device. Plug the LC
connector at one end of another fiber cable into the Tx port of the router and the LC connector at
the other end to the Rx port of the peer device.
